Protein Name: LL-diaminopimelate aminotransferase, chloroplastic

UniprotKB/SwissProt ID: Q93ZN9 (Q93ZN9)

Gene Name: DAP

Organism: Arabidopsis thaliana (Mouse-ear cress)

Function: Required for lysine biosynthesis. Catalyzes the direct conversion of tetrahydrodipicolinate to LL-diaminopimelate, a reaction that requires three enzymes in E.coli. Not active with meso-diaminopimelate, lysine or ornithine as substrates

Other Modifications: View all modification sites in dbPTM

Protein Subcellular Localization: Plastid, chloroplast
